    Specificity
    This product is an IgG fraction antibody purified from monospecific antiserum by a multi-step process which includes delipidation, salt fractionation and ion exchange chromatography followed by extensive dialysis against the buffer stated above. This purified antibody has been heated to 56°C for 30 minutes. In ELISA and other immunoreactive assays, this antibody will recognize both native and recombinant human IL-9 in cell supernatants and certain body fluids. A control of similarly diluted normal rabbit IgG is recommended.
    Characteristics
    IL-9 is a cytokine that acts as a regulator of a variety of hematopoietic cells. This cytokine stimulates cell proliferation and prevents apoptosis. It functions through the interleukin 9 receptor (IL9R), which activates different signal transducer and activator (STAT) proteins and thus connects this cytokine to various biological processes. The gene encoding this cytokine has been identified as a candidate gene for asthma. Genetic studies on a mouse model of asthma demonstrated that this cytokine is a determining factor in the pathogenesis of bronchial hyperresponsiveness.

  • Application Notes
    This purified antibody has been tested for use in ELISA and western blotting. By western blot a band approximately 15 kDa in size corresponding to human IL-9 protein is expected in the appropriate cell lysate or extract. Specific conditions for reactivity should be optimized by the end user.
